The top bid for the ‘last’ Holden Commodore assembled in Australia has more than doubled in less than 24 hours and now sits at $255,000 – with two days remaining before the auction concludes.
The status of the vehicle is disputed – officially, the last Holden Commodore to ceremonially roll off the production line was kept by General Motors.
However, the example listed for sale has the last Vehicle Identification Number (VIN), was the last body to be built, and was the last car through the paint…
